Output 172bfb3669367abecdf53fd9e4679aa45a25744cdae395bef2cd850425d759a3:752

value
2976566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0931e5c36fe3d3651f0baa81c4807a8003238e4d OP_EQUAL
address
32XdnD9VR388w1dG4c5bPw3eTC8qCYt5Zh
transaction
172bfb3669367abecdf53fd9e4679aa45a25744cdae395bef2cd850425d759a3
spent
true